PURPOSE: To improve the SNR of a multiple signal by raising a multiple level higher than that of other area, in an area which is called an overscan part and does not appear on a display screen, and lowering the multiple level in other part, and executing the transmission.
CONSTITUTION: As for an input signal, a rearrangement of the signal. is executed, and it is assumed that a multiple signal is superposed to the upper and the lower bar parts. In this case, on a transmitting side, by a line counter circuit 2 for inputting a synchronizing signal, a line counter value is outputted, and based on the counter value, a coefficient for controlling a multiple level is generated by a coefficient generator 5. By multiplying this coefficient by an input signal by a multiplier 1, a desired signal is obtained. On the other hand, on a receiving side, as well, a line counter value is outputted by a line counter circuit 5, and based on the counter value, a coefficient for controlling a level expansion is generated by a coefficient generator 6. By multiplying this coefficient by an input signal by a multiplier 4, a desired signal is obtained.
